What do they mean? You configured with --enable-debug or --enable-maintainer-mode, which set the SVN_DEBUG flag. Those "tracing" lines represent additional "stack frames" in the error chain, which the developers use to help track down where errors come from. For production code, they will not exist. Cheers, -g
